At around 11 o'clock in the evening last Friday, Typhoon Sendong (international name: Washi) struck Mindanao (Southern Philippines) that led to flash floods and landslides that destroyed properties and killed hundreds of people. The cities of Cagayan de Oro (CDO) and Iligan suffered mostly from the typhoon and are now in need of our help.
